Transactions

The transactions table provides indexed views of all transactions submitted for a specified chain.

Columns

Name Description Type
block_number The block number the transaction was included in. integer
timestamp The transaction's timestamp (in ISO-8601 format). timestamp
transaction_hash The transaction's hash. text
base_fee_per_gas The base fee to include a transaction in the block (in Wei per gas unit). numeric
max_priority_fee_per_gas The maximum priority fee used by the transaction (in Wei per gas unit). numeric
max_fee_per_gas The maximum fee used by the transaction (in Wei per gas unit). numeric
gas_limit The maximum amount of gas that can be used in the transaction (in gas units). numeric
gas_used The amount of gas used in the transaction (in gas units). numeric
gas_price The actual price of gas used in the transaction (in Wei per gas unit). numeric
transaction_fee The gas fee paid by the transaction (in Wei). numeric
fees_burned The amount of transaction fees burned by the transaction (see EIP-1559) (in Wei). numeric
fees_rewarded The amount of transaction fees rewarded to the miner of the transaction (in Wei). numeric
fees_saved The amount of transaction fees saved by the transaction (in Wei). numeric
nonce The transaction sender's nonce. integer
position The position of the transaction in the block. integer
type The type of the transaction (see EIP-1559, EIP-2718). integer
from_address The address of the transaction's sender. text
to_address The address of the transaction's recipient, if any. text
value The amount sent by the transaction (in Wei). numeric
contract_address The address of the contract created by the transaction, if any. text
input The input data for the transaction. text
output The output data for the transaction. text
internal_transaction_count The number of internal transactions produced in the transaction. integer
log_count The number of logs produced in the transaction. integer
__confirmed Flag indicating whether the transaction has been confirmed. boolean

Indexes

The following indexes are available for this table:

(__confirmed) WHERE __confirmed = false
(block_number, position)
(timestamp, position)
(from_address, block_number, position)
(to_address, block_number, position)
(to_address, LEFT(input, 10), block_number, position)
